#d39f26 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d39f26 is composed of 82.7% red, 62.4%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.6% magenta, 82%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 42 degrees, a saturation of 69.5% and a lightness of 48.8%. #d39f26 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ff4c with #a73f00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

Shades and Tints of #d39f26

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0902 is the darkest color, while #fefdfa is the lightest one.
